嵌入式开发的主流平台是ARM+Linux,所以达内嵌入式课程以ARM+Linux 为主干,同时通过赠送在线智能硬件视频课程,掌握基于ARM Cortex-M(Stm32) 系列开发并且达内与英国 ARM 公司共同推出的嵌入式培训课程完全覆盖 ARM AAE 认证课程,是具备国际标准的嵌入式课程。
技术进阶、应届毕业生、在职转行
线上授课
随时可学、不受时间地点限制
模块 | 课程内容 | 项目贯穿 |
标准 C 及数据结构 | ||
计算机概述 | 开发环境的搭建、linux 常见命令的使用 | 扫雷/ 俄罗斯方块 等小游戏 |
标准 C 语言(C99标准) | 数据类型、类型转换、进制、流程控制、标准库函数、数组、指针、IO 流 | |
数据结构和算法 | 堆栈、队列、链表、二叉树、冒泡排序、插入排序、快速排序等 | |
linux 系统级开发 | ||
Linux 文件系统 | 文件读写的基本操作、文件描述符、读写锁机制、系统与标准 IO | Web 服务器 |
Linux 内存管理 | 内存管理、进程映射、虚拟内存、内存映射的建立与解除 | |
Linux 进程管理 | 子进程创建、进程间通讯(消息队列 / 共享内存/ 管道等)、信号捕获和处理 | |
Linux 线程管理 | 线程创建、线程同步技术(互斥锁 / 条件变量 / 信号量) | |
网络通讯 | 网络与网络协议、TCP、UDP 网络通讯底层协议 | |
标准 C++ 及QT 框架库 | ||
C++ 基础部分 | 名字空间、重载、各种数据类型的操作 | 智能监控系统(人脸识别、报警音乐) |
C++ 高级部分 | 类和对象、构造、析构、继承、封装、多态、智能指针、auto、异常处理、IO 流等 | |
QT 框架库基础 | 字符处理、组件类、容器类、Qt 设计师、元对象编译器、Qt 创造器、事件处理 | |
智能监控系统 | mjpg_stremer 视频服务器、mjpg_stremer客户端、日志文件、 | |
ARM 裸板及系统移植 | ||
ARM 裸板开发 | GPIO、UART、I2C 总线协议及工作原理、 SHELL 开发、单寄存器加载存储、ARM 汇编程序设计、ARM 异常处理、中断处理 | 智能家居裸板实现及环境搭建 |
系统移植 | 嵌入式 Linux 系统安装部署实践、u-boot 移植实践、Linux 内核源码编译、根文件系统介绍、根文件系统制作与部署 | |
大项目实战 | ||
Linux 底层驱动开发 | 建立开发环境、Linux 驱动开发基础、Linux字符设备驱动程序 设计、Linux 中断顶半部与底半部、Linux 设备驱动程序中的并发控制、Linux 设备驱动程序中阻塞与非阻塞、Linux 内核内存分配、 Linux 内核内存映射(mmap)、Linux 内核 platform、Linux 内核 I2C 驱动子系统 项目需求文档、开发环境建立、系统硬件驱 | 智能家居系统驱动搭建 |
项目实战 | 动开发和应用、系统登录与认证、NBIot 无线通讯模块、WIFI 模块 & 网络配置、视频监控模块、音乐播放模块、舵机模块、超声波测距原理等 | 智能家居系统综合版本,智能小车 |
标准C及数据结构
计算机概述
标准 C 语言(C99标准)
数据结构和算法
标准 C 语言(C99标准)
数据结构和算法
linux系统级开发
Linux 文件系统
Linux 内存管理
Linux 进程管理
Linux 线程管理
网络通讯
Linux 内存管理
Linux 进程管理
Linux 线程管理
网络通讯
标准C++及QT框架库
C++ 基础部分
C++ 高级部分
QT 框架库基础
智能监控系统
C++ 高级部分
QT 框架库基础
智能监控系统
ARM 裸板及系统移植
ARM 裸板开发
系统移植
系统移植
大项目实战
Linux 底层驱动开发
智能家居系统综合版本,智能小车
智能家居系统综合版本,智能小车
1
1. 讲师优
2
2. 实战强
3
3. 技术新
4
4. 教法好
5
5. 前景美
6
6. 追时代
01
软件开发基础:
(Linux 基础,gcc 工具,标准C,数据结构,面向对象标准C++)
02
嵌入式驱动开发:
(ARM 体系结构和接口编程,Linux 系统移植裁剪,根文件系统制作,Linux驱动框架和驱动编程)
03
LInux高级环境编程:
(Linux 文件编程,多线程,多进程编程,网络编程,Qt 图形界面编程)
04
嵌入式项目实战:
( 软硬选型设计及架构设计,驱动开发(传感器驱动,IIC 驱动,电机舵机驱动,wifi 驱动),应用层开发,openCV 视觉AI,项目部署)
01
人才需求
嵌入式系统的应用已涉及到生产、工作、生活各个方面。我国国民经济和国防建设的各个方面存在着广泛的应用,有着巨大的市场。
02
就业薪资
北京嵌入式平均工资:¥ 17080/ 月,取自 8182 份样本( 数据来源职友集)
当前文章URL:http://www.haoxue365.com/course/5410.html